Company Overview - Boreton Technology Co., Ltd. (referred to as "Boreton") was listed on the Hong Kong Stock Exchange on May 7, 2025, with a first-day increase of 49.17%, closing at HKD 26.85 per share [2] - On the opening day, Boreton's stock rose by 63.89%, reaching HKD 29.5 per share, with a total market capitalization of approximately HKD 160.76 billion [3] IPO Details - Boreton's IPO involved the issuance of 13 million shares, with the Hong Kong public offering being oversubscribed by 198.72 times [3] - The company secured cornerstone investors, including Xinwangda and Changfeng Fund, which collectively subscribed approximately HKD 63.5 million [3] Fund Utilization - The funds raised from the IPO will be allocated for technology advancement, new product and service development, establishing manufacturing facilities, enhancing manufacturing capabilities, expanding sales and service networks, increasing brand awareness, and general corporate purposes [3] Business Strategy - Boreton's chairman, Chen Fangming, emphasized the company's commitment to advancing new productivity through the "unmanned smart mining" solution, integrating autonomous driving technology with energy management systems to achieve zero-carbon and automated operations in mining [3] - The company aims to explore emerging markets in Southeast Asia, the Middle East, and Africa, leveraging differentiated competitiveness for global expansion [3] Market Position - In 2024, Boreton held a market share of 18.3% in the Chinese new energy wide-body dump truck sector and 3.8% in the new energy loader sector, ranking third and seventh respectively [3] - Boreton is the only pure new energy construction machinery manufacturer among the top five manufacturers in these categories, focusing exclusively on the research and production of pure new energy construction machinery [3] Financial Performance - Boreton's revenue for the years 2022 to 2024 was RMB 360 million, RMB 464 million, and RMB 635 million, respectively, with annual losses of RMB 178 million, RMB 229 million, and RMB 275 million [4] - The adjusted net losses (non-IFRS measures) for the same period were RMB 143 million, RMB 190 million, and RMB 218 million [4] - Despite current losses, the company anticipates potential profitability in the future due to the expanding market for zero-carbon mining robots and ongoing technological advancements [4]
